Why English Tuition Matters in Singapore’s Education System
English proficiency is crucial in Singapore’s education landscape for several compelling reasons. As a core subject in the PSLE, O-Levels, and A-Levels, English significantly impacts a student’s overall academic standing. Beyond examination results, strong English skills form the foundation for learning across all subjects, from understanding complex mathematical problems to interpreting scientific concepts.
The Singapore education system places heavy emphasis on various English components including composition writing, comprehension, oral communication, and grammar. Many students find certain aspects challenging, particularly the nuanced requirements of comprehension and the creative demands of composition writing.
English tuition centres provide specialized instruction that often goes beyond what schools can offer in a standard classroom setting. With smaller class sizes and targeted teaching approaches, these centres can address individual learning gaps and extend high-performing students. For students struggling with specific components of English, professional tuition can make a significant difference in building confidence and improving results.
Criteria for Selecting the Best English Tuition Centres
When evaluating English tuition centres in Singapore, several key factors distinguish the exceptional from the merely adequate. Understanding these criteria will help you make a more informed choice:
Teacher Qualifications and Experience
The quality of instruction largely depends on the qualifications and experience of the tutors. Look for centres with teachers who have relevant academic backgrounds (degrees in English Literature, Linguistics, or Education), teaching certifications, and substantial experience with Singapore’s curriculum. The most effective English tutors combine strong subject knowledge with an ability to engage students and explain complex concepts clearly.
Track Record and Results
Reputable tuition centres should be able to demonstrate a consistent track record of student improvement and achievement. This may be reflected in testimonials, before-and-after performance data, or the percentage of students who achieve distinction grades in national examinations. While past results don’t guarantee future outcomes, they provide insight into the centre’s effectiveness.
Curriculum and Teaching Methodology
The curriculum should align with MOE guidelines while offering value-added elements that enhance learning. Progressive centres often incorporate creative approaches to language acquisition, critical thinking exercises, and exposure to diverse texts. The teaching methodology should balance fundamental skills development with higher-order thinking, adapting to different learning styles and needs.
Class Size and Individual Attention
Smaller class sizes generally allow for more personalized attention and feedback, which is particularly important for a skills-based subject like English. Consider whether your child thrives in small group settings or benefits more from one-on-one instruction, and select a centre that offers an appropriate student-to-teacher ratio.

Teaching Methodologies and Learning Approaches
Effective English tuition centres employ diverse teaching methodologies to engage students and enhance learning outcomes. Understanding these approaches can help you select a centre that aligns with your child’s learning style:
Literature-Based Learning
Some centres use literature as a foundation for teaching language skills, exposing students to high-quality texts that demonstrate excellent writing. This approach helps students develop vocabulary, understand narrative structures, and appreciate language nuances through authentic reading experiences. Literature-based learning cultivates a deeper appreciation of language while building analytical skills through text discussion and interpretation.
Skills-Focused Instruction
This approach breaks down English into specific skill sets (grammar, vocabulary, comprehension techniques, composition planning) and addresses each component systematically. Skills-focused instruction works well for students who need to strengthen particular areas of weakness or prepare for examinations with clearly defined assessment criteria. The structured nature of this methodology provides clear learning objectives and measurable progress.
Examination-Oriented Training
Some centres emphasize examination techniques and strategies, teaching students to interpret questions accurately, manage time effectively, and structure answers to maximize marks. While this approach is highly practical for improving grades, the most effective centres balance examination preparation with genuine language development, ensuring students develop transferable skills alongside examination proficiency.
Multimedia and Technology Integration
Progressive English tuition centres incorporate digital tools, interactive platforms, and multimedia resources to enhance engagement and cater to diverse learning preferences. This might include online writing platforms, video analysis, digital feedback systems, or interactive grammar exercises. Technology integration can make learning more accessible and engaging while preparing students for the increasingly digital nature of communication.

Fee Structures and Value for Money
English tuition fees in Singapore vary considerably depending on the centre’s reputation, teacher qualifications, class size, and program level. Understanding the typical fee ranges and what constitutes value for money can help you make an informed decision:
Typical Fee Ranges
For primary level English tuition, group classes typically range from $30 to $70 per hour, with premium centres charging on the higher end. Secondary level tuition generally costs between $40 to $90 per hour, while JC level or specialized programs like GP preparation can range from $50 to $120 per hour. Individual or small group tuition (3-4 students) commands higher rates, often starting from $70 per hour for primary levels and increasing for higher levels.
Additional Costs
Beyond the base tuition fees, consider other potential costs when calculating the total investment. Many centres charge registration fees ($50-$150), material fees for proprietary resources, and assessment fees for placement tests. Some centres require term-based payment (typically 10-12 weeks) rather than monthly payments, creating larger upfront costs. Ask about these additional expenses when inquiring to avoid surprises.
Evaluating Value for Money
While cost is an important consideration, evaluating value means looking beyond the hourly rate. Consider the teacher-to-student ratio, the qualifications of teachers, the quality of materials provided, the availability of additional support (consultations, online resources), and most importantly, the demonstrated results. Sometimes paying more for a highly effective program proves more economical than switching between less expensive but less effective options.

How to Choose the Right English Tuition Centre for Your Child
Finding the perfect match between your child’s learning needs and a tuition centre requires thoughtful consideration of multiple factors. Here’s a practical approach to making this important decision:
Identify Your Child’s Specific Needs
Begin by clearly identifying what aspects of English your child needs help with. Is it composition writing, comprehension, oral communication, vocabulary building, or grammar? Different centres have different strengths, and understanding your child’s specific needs will help you find a program that addresses those areas effectively. Review school feedback, examine past assignments, and discuss with your child’s school teachers to pinpoint the exact areas requiring attention.
Consider Your Child’s Learning Style
Each child has unique learning preferences. Some thrive in interactive group discussions, while others prefer structured, systematic instruction. Some learn best through creative activities, while others benefit from analytical approaches. Observe how your child learns most effectively and look for a centre whose teaching methodology aligns with these preferences. During trial classes, pay attention to whether your child seems engaged and responsive to the teaching approach.
Evaluate Practical Considerations
Practical factors often determine whether a tuition arrangement is sustainable. Consider the location and travel time, especially in relation to your child’s school schedule and your family’s other commitments. Evaluate whether the class schedule conflicts with other important activities or allows adequate rest time. Assess whether the fee structure fits within your budget, considering both the base tuition and additional costs.
Request a Trial Class
Most reputable centres offer trial classes or assessment sessions. Take advantage of these opportunities to observe the teaching quality, class dynamics, and your child’s response to the environment. After the trial, discuss with your child their comfort level and whether they felt they could learn effectively in that setting. Pay attention to whether the teacher was able to engage your child and explain concepts clearly.
